Transaction 07f953948fff7277535a3b93b57db74abfc65b69c8ce2eba3dab76086e692bb0

59 Input
1 Outputs
  • 07f953948fff7277535a3b93b57db74abfc65b69c8ce2eba3dab76086e692bb0:0
  • value  20000000
    address  3DXtQSW8mv8Sa6FiN8hKEAD3zdaxQsa6Fc